Omega Speedmaster Blue Origin
The Omega Speedmaster has a rich heritage that dates back to 1957 when it was introduced as a racing and sports chronograph. Over the years, the Speedmaster has evolved into a symbol of precision and innovation, earning its place as the "Moonwatch" for its association with NASA's space missions. The Blue Side Of The Moon Blue ceramic watch pays homage to this illustrious history while adding a contemporary twist with its striking blue ceramic case and dial.

Omega Speedmaster Moonwatch Blue
The Speedmaster Blue Side Of The Moon is a modern interpretation of the classic Moonwatch, featuring a blue ceramic case and dial that set it apart from traditional stainless steel models. The 44.25mm case size is substantial yet comfortable on the wrist, while the blue ceramic bezel adds a touch of sporty elegance to the design. The watch is powered by the Omega Co-Axial Master Chronometer Calibre 9904, ensuring precision and reliability in timekeeping.

Omega Speedmaster Also Called
The Omega Speedmaster is often referred to as the "Moonwatch" due to its association with NASA's Apollo missions, where it became the first watch worn on the moon in 1969. The Speedmaster's reputation for precision and reliability has made it a favorite among astronauts, pilots, and watch enthusiasts alike.
